Obituary: "Hazel Marie Hill (nee Van Hyning), 96, of Norwalk, died Tuesday, January 16, 2007, in Norwalk Memorial Nursing Home. She was born February 21, 1910, in Jefferson Township. She lived in Vermilion for 51 years, moving to New London in 1998 and to Norwalk in 2000. Mrs. Hill was a member of the Vermilion Evangelical and Reformed Church and graduated from high school in 1929. She enjoyed playing cards, gardening, flower beds and quilting. Survivors include her sons Henry James Hill of Prescott, Arizona, and Tom Hill of New London; sister, Helen Wilcox of Bellefontaine; and four grandchildren, eight great-grandchildren and nieces and nephews. She was preceded in death by her husband, Arthur Hill, in 1999; her parents, James and Leota Mae (nee Wickersham) Van Hyning; brothers James ''Bud'' Van Hyning and Robert Van Hyning; and sisters Ruth Kelley, Kathryn King and Alice Van Hyning. Friends may call Friday, 6 to 9 pm, and Saturday from 11 am until the service at noon at Riddle Funeral Home, 5345 South Street, Vermilion. The Reverend William A. Seith will officiate. Burial will follow in Brownhelm Cemetery, Vermilion. Memorial contributions may be made to Norwalk Memorial Nursing Home, 272 Benedict Ave, Norwalk, Ohio 44857."
